central nervous system

英 [ˌsentrəl ˈnɜːvəs sɪstəm]

美 [ˌsentrəl ˈnɜːrvəs sɪstəm]

n.  中枢神经系统

医学计算机

牛津词典

    noun

    • 中枢神经系统
      the part of the system of nerves in the body that consists of the brain and the spinal cord

      柯林斯词典

      • 中枢神经系统
        Yourcentral nervous systemis the part of your nervous system that consists of the brain and spinal cord.
